Description
Built in small numbers at Keratl/Silver Laurel (Hinterworlds 1730), these are converted merchant free traders. A small amount for reinforced bracing was added to support the hull plates and the engine room was gutted to accommodate the largest maneuver drives and power plants that would fit. The original commercial jump drive was retained, the result is pretty quick and agile. A pair of triple turrets carry a total of four beam lasers and a pair of missile racks. Nuclear tipped ordinance is used to discourage unwelcome visitors.
Some Stalker Yellow Jackets were believed to be built as Q-ships, or as heavily armed merchant ships with concealed weaponry.
